2.1. Foundational Elements of Precision

The first pillar of Sheffer Craig emphasizes the absolute necessity of accurate timekeeping and synchronization. Just as a conductor relies on a precise metronome, anyone engaging in time-sensitive digital activities must have an exact reference point. This goes beyond simply checking a standard clock; it involves understanding the specific server time of the platform in question. For instance, online ticketing platforms, university registration portals, and even stock trading systems operate on their own internal server clocks, which may differ slightly from a user's local device time. The Sheffer Craig approach advocates for: * **Real-time Server Time Monitoring:** Utilizing tools that display the exact server time of target platforms, often down to milliseconds, is crucial. This eliminates discrepancies between local device time and the actual system clock. * **Latency Awareness:** Understanding network latency – the delay between a user's action and the server's response – is vital. A fraction of a second in latency can negate perfect timing. The framework encourages users to test and minimize their latency as much as possible. * **System Readiness:** Ensuring all technical prerequisites are met, such as stable internet connection, updated browsers, and pre-filled forms, to minimize any potential delays on the user's end. These foundational elements create the baseline for any successful time-sensitive operation, ensuring that external variables are controlled to the greatest extent possible.

3.1. Case Studies in Efficiency

Consider the following scenarios where a Sheffer Craig approach could dramatically improve outcomes: * **Online Ticket Sales (Concerts, Sports, Events):** This is perhaps the most visible application. Millions of users simultaneously vie for a limited number of tickets. A Sheffer Craig practitioner would not only synchronize their clock to the exact server time of the ticketing platform but also pre-fill all necessary information, ensure a stable, low-latency internet connection, and even have multiple devices or browsers ready as a backup. They understand that a 0.1-second advantage can mean securing a coveted seat versus missing out entirely. The difference between success and failure often boils down to this meticulous preparation and execution at the precise moment. * **University Course Registration:** Students often face intense competition for popular courses. Universities typically open registration at a specific server time. A Sheffer Craig approach would involve identifying the exact server time, pre-selecting courses, understanding the system's queueing mechanism, and having a lightning-fast click speed. The ability to register within the first few seconds can determine a student's academic schedule for the semester. * **High-Frequency Trading (Conceptual Link):** While highly complex, the principles of Sheffer Craig resonate with the world of high-frequency trading, where algorithms execute trades in microseconds based on minute price fluctuations. 4. Optimizing Performance with Sheffer Craig

Implementing the Sheffer Craig framework isn't just about understanding precision; it's about actively optimizing one's performance to consistently achieve desired outcomes. This involves a continuous cycle of preparation, execution, and analysis, aimed at refining the approach over time. Optimization under Sheffer Craig encompasses several key areas: * **Technological Leverage:** Utilizing specialized tools and software designed to enhance speed and accuracy. This might include browser extensions that auto-fill forms, dedicated server time checkers, or even hardware upgrades that reduce input lag. The idea is to automate and streamline as many steps as possible to minimize human error and reaction time. * **Environmental Control:** Creating an optimal operating environment. This means ensuring a quiet, distraction-free space, using a wired internet connection instead of Wi-Fi for stability, and closing unnecessary background applications that might consume bandwidth or processing power. Every minor improvement contributes to the overall success rate. * **Practice and Simulation:** For high-stakes events, rehearsing the process can be invaluable. Running through the steps, even if it's just clicking through a dummy website, helps build muscle memory and identifies potential bottlenecks before the real event. This reduces anxiety and improves execution speed.
